IAP GITLAB

Commit 24d782a0 authored by Tanguy Pierog's avatar Tanguy Pierog

add urqmd 1.3 as in CONEX/CORSIKA. No test done and interface not updated (only EPOS part)


git-svn-id: https://devel-ik.fzk.de/svn/mc/crmc/trunk@7467 c7a5e08c-de06-0410-9364-b41cf42a0b17
parent 3c2dc888
...@@ -105,7 +105,7 @@ LIST(APPEND CRMC_SOURCES src/OutputPolicyHepMC.cc) ...@@ -105,7 +105,7 @@ LIST(APPEND CRMC_SOURCES src/OutputPolicyHepMC.cc)
add_definitions(-DWITH_HEPMC) add_definitions(-DWITH_HEPMC)
MESSAGE("Build HEPMC Output Interface") MESSAGE("Build HEPMC Output Interface")
FIND_PACKAGE (Fastjet REQUIRED COMPONENTS fastjet) FIND_PACKAGE (Fastjet COMPONENTS fastjet)
if (FASTJET_FOUND) if (FASTJET_FOUND)
include_directories("${Fastjet_INCLUDE_DIRS}") include_directories("${Fastjet_INCLUDE_DIRS}")
add_definitions(-DWITH_FASTJET) add_definitions(-DWITH_FASTJET)
......
...@@ -56,6 +56,12 @@ ...@@ -56,6 +56,12 @@
#endif #endif
model=9 model=9
endif endif
if(cmodel(1:n).eq.'urqmd' )then
#ifndef __URQMD__
stop'please compile with requested model'
#endif
model=10
endif
if(cmodel(1:n).eq.'dpmjet' )then if(cmodel(1:n).eq.'dpmjet' )then
#ifndef __DPMJET__ #ifndef __DPMJET__
stop'please compile with requested model' stop'please compile with requested model'
...@@ -126,6 +132,13 @@ ...@@ -126,6 +132,13 @@
stop'please compile with requested model' stop'please compile with requested model'
#else #else
call IniFluka call IniFluka
#endif
endif
if(model.eq.10) then
#ifndef __URQMD__
stop'please compile with requested model'
#else
call IniUrQMD
#endif #endif
endif endif
if(model.eq.12) then if(model.eq.12) then
...@@ -207,6 +220,13 @@ ...@@ -207,6 +220,13 @@
stop'please compile with requested model' stop'please compile with requested model'
#else #else
call IniEvtFlu call IniEvtFlu
#endif
endif
if(model.eq.10)then
#ifndef __URQMD__
stop'please compile with requested model'
#else
call IniEvtUrq
#endif #endif
endif endif
if(model.eq.12)then if(model.eq.12)then
...@@ -284,6 +304,13 @@ ...@@ -284,6 +304,13 @@
stop'please compile with requested model' stop'please compile with requested model'
#else #else
call emsflu(iret) call emsflu(iret)
#endif
endif
if(model.eq.10) then
#ifndef __URQMD__
stop'please compile with requested model'
#else
call emsurq(iret)
#endif #endif
endif endif
if(model.eq.12) then if(model.eq.12) then
...@@ -321,6 +348,7 @@ ...@@ -321,6 +348,7 @@
subroutine crseaaModel0(sigt,sigi,sigc,sige) subroutine crseaaModel0(sigt,sigi,sigc,sige)
include 'epos.inc' include 'epos.inc'
common/geom/rmproj,rmtarg,bmax,bkmx
double precision GTOT,GPROD,GABS,GDD,GQEL,GCOH double precision GTOT,GPROD,GABS,GDD,GQEL,GCOH
double precision e0 double precision e0
...@@ -424,6 +452,15 @@ ...@@ -424,6 +452,15 @@
sige=0. sige=0.
sigc=0. sigc=0.
sigi=flucrse(ekin,maproj,matarg,idtargin) sigi=flucrse(ekin,maproj,matarg,idtargin)
#endif
elseif(model.eq.10)then
#ifndef __URQMD__
stop'please compile with requested model'
#else
sigi=0.
sige=0.
sigc=0.
sigt=urqcrse(ekin,idproj,maproj,matarg,idtarg,bmax)
#endif #endif
elseif(model.eq.12)then elseif(model.eq.12)then
#ifndef __DPMJET__ #ifndef __DPMJET__
......
Copyright
UrQMD source and documentation are provided freely for the purpose of
checking and reproducing published results of the authors.
The Open Standard Codes and Routines (OSCAR)-Group has established -
for good reasons - guidelines for reproducablity, usage and quality
control of simlulations codes for pA and AA collsions.
UrQMD is a complex model. In order to ensure that it is used correctly
that all results are reproducible and that the proper credits are
given we ask for your agreement to the following copyright and
safeguard mechanisms in the OSCAR spirit.
The UrQMD collaboration favors cooperation and joint projects with
outside researchers. We encourage experimental collaborations to
compare their results to UrQMD. We support you and/or cooperate on any
sensible project related to UrQMD
If you are interested in a project, please contact us.
Projects without the participation of the UrQMD-Collaboration are
accepted, if the project is not a current thesis topic of any
UrQMD-Collaboration member.
We expect that the code authors are informed about any changes and
modifications made to the code. Any changes to the official version
must be documented.
The code or any fragments of it shall not be given away to third
parties. Similarily, events generated with UrQMD shall not be given
to third parties without consent of the code authors.
10.01.2008 UrQMD 1.3 to be used with Corsika.
The stand-alone version of the UrQMD code is available at http://th.physik.uni-frankfurt.de/~urqmd/
# 3 9 41
0.112201847 387.735748
0.141253754 365.124329
0.177827939 334.358948
0.22387211 301.178223
0.281838298 278.320953
0.354813397 267.669098
0.446683586 270.194885
0.562341332 285.830109
0.707945764 306.532166
0.891250908 323.192963
1.12201846 327.179108
1.41253757 331.665009
1.77827942 328.868958
2.23872113 328.903687
2.81838298 324.322296
3.54813385 320.950836
4.46683598 318.933197
5.62341309 316.883545
7.07945776 314.973846
8.91250896 313.424438
11.2201843 311.178955
14.1253757 309.350067
17.782795 307.822479
22.3872108 306.498657
28.1838284 305.465149
35.4813385 304.727264
44.6683578 304.115204
56.2341309 303.78595
70.7945786 303.671173
89.1250916 303.838684
112.201843 304.221558
141.253754 304.872314
177.827942 305.749512
223.872116 306.880402
281.838287 308.308441
354.813385 310.019836
446.683594 311.941711
562.341309 314.06601
707.945801 316.412506
891.250916 319.166779
1122.01843 321.884796
0.112201847 763.341248
0.141253754 724.467651
0.177827939 690.23114
0.22387211 652.411133
0.281838298 617.450745
0.354813397 592.474243
0.446683586 567.946289
0.562341332 548.473511
0.707945764 527.429443
0.891250908 513.641541
1.12201846 498.007446
1.41253757 483.648743
1.77827942 466.958282
2.23872113 452.280029
2.81838298 437.148499
3.54813385 420.556885
4.46683598 406.182434
5.62341309 394.64444
7.07945776 384.184845
8.91250896 374.364807
11.2201843 365.634613
14.1253757 357.844238
17.782795 350.750488
22.3872108 344.562164
28.1838284 339.175964
35.4813385 334.760681
44.6683578 330.822815
56.2341309 327.782684
70.7945786 325.333649
89.1250916 323.188599
112.201843 321.814667
141.253754 320.985291
177.827942 320.436768
223.872116 320.322601
281.838287 320.516571
354.813385 321.123108
446.683594 321.824036
562.341309 322.945831
707.945801 324.378357
891.250916 326.083984
1122.01843 327.79303
0.112201847 388.693909
0.141253754 364.602295
0.177827939 332.876068
0.22387211 301.326355
0.281838298 279.389771
0.354813397 267.447052
0.446683586 269.233765
0.562341332 287.057709
0.707945764 307.336182
0.891250908 322.515625
1.12201846 328.393951
1.41253757 330.574219
1.77827942 328.868958
2.23872113 328.903687
2.81838298 324.322296
3.54813385 320.950836
4.46683598 318.933197
5.62341309 316.883545
7.07945776 314.973846
8.91250896 313.424438
11.2201843 311.178955
14.1253757 309.350067
17.782795 307.822479
22.3872108 306.498657
28.1838284 305.465149
35.4813385 304.727264
44.6683578 304.115204
56.2341309 303.78595
70.7945786 303.671173
89.1250916 303.838684
112.201843 304.221558
141.253754 304.872314
177.827942 305.749512
223.872116 306.880402
281.838287 308.308441
354.813385 310.019836
446.683594 311.941711
562.341309 314.06601
707.945801 316.412506
891.250916 319.166779
1122.01843 321.884796
0.112201847 762.487061
0.141253754 725.587524
0.177827939 688.470581
0.22387211 651.869324
0.281838298 616.906799
0.354813397 591.767212
0.446683586 569.406921
0.562341332 549.702393
0.707945764 529.844971
0.891250908 513.188843
1.12201846 499.006531
1.41253757 481.01767
1.77827942 466.958282
2.23872113 452.280029
2.81838298 437.148499
3.54813385 420.556885
4.46683598 406.182434
5.62341309 394.64444
7.07945776 384.184845
8.91250896 374.364807
11.2201843 365.634613
14.1253757 357.844238
17.782795 350.750488
22.3872108 344.562164
28.1838284 339.175964
35.4813385 334.760681
44.6683578 330.822815
56.2341309 327.782684
70.7945786 325.333649
89.1250916 323.188599
112.201843 321.814667
141.253754 320.985291
177.827942 320.436768
223.872116 320.322601
281.838287 320.516571
354.813385 321.123108
446.683594 321.824036
562.341309 322.945831
707.945801 324.378357
891.250916 326.083984
1122.01843 327.79303
0.112201847 208.893692
0.141253754 389.222809
0.177827939 545.146118
0.22387211 553.704041
0.281838298 454.354004
0.354813397 353.333038
0.446683586 289.083923
0.562341332 273.630829
0.707945764 275.764099
0.891250908 278.958771
1.12201846 264.621155
1.41253757 272.059082
1.77827942 253.971954
2.23872113 253.971954
2.81838298 253.971954
3.54813385 248.899826
4.46683598 243.72467
5.62341309 238.937378
7.07945776 234.904541
8.91250896 231.377533
11.2201843 228.142212
14.1253757 225.558731
17.782795 223.374802
22.3872108 221.624268
28.1838284 220.298676
35.4813385 219.517258
44.6683578 218.979553
56.2341309 218.85582
70.7945786 219.072388
89.1250916 219.690735
112.201843 220.410248
141.253754 221.598877
177.827942 222.987122
223.872116 224.739609
281.838287 226.583038
354.813385 228.656448
446.683594 231.129501
562.341309 233.475143
707.945801 236.291473
891.250916 238.93959
1122.01843 242.143494
0.112201847 207.278656
0.141253754 388.457092
0.177827939 543.423218
0.22387211 552.497253
0.281838298 457.476135
0.354813397 352.912567
0.446683586 291.198029
0.562341332 273.852783
0.707945764 275.490387
0.891250908 297.836243
1.12201846 286.545013
1.41253757 275.336426
1.77827942 272.414886
2.23872113 269.271759
2.81838298 264.201019
3.54813385 257.677856
4.46683598 251.572128
5.62341309 246.224396
7.07945776 241.652863
8.91250896 237.702164
11.2201843 234.190689
14.1253757 231.353516
17.782795 228.777084
22.3872108 226.828827
28.1838284 225.188049
35.4813385 224.005783
44.6683578 223.175568
56.2341309 222.707916
70.7945786 222.579803
89.1250916 222.794785
112.201843 223.262924
141.253754 224.086563
177.827942 225.18779
223.872116 226.618149
281.838287 228.256516
354.813385 230.200577
446.683594 232.388428
562.341309 234.783203
707.945801 237.419662
891.250916 240.209274
1122.01843 243.301804
0.112201847 135.161758
0.141253754 138.938248
0.177827939 137.553207
0.22387211 139.265778
0.281838298 137.290482
0.354813397 138.468704
0.446683586 142.099014
0.562341332 158.778427
0.707945764 174.589584
0.891250908 179.889023
1.12201846 180.75441
1.41253757 180.679306
1.77827942 182.160004
2.23872113 181.371536
2.81838298 180.732391
3.54813385 180.17926
4.46683598 179.853134
5.62341309 179.5737
7.07945776 179.483307
8.91250896 179.606461
11.2201843 179.83783
14.1253757 180.286896
17.782795 180.862701
22.3872108 181.692093
28.1838284 182.688934
35.4813385 183.836594
44.6683578 185.199234
56.2341309 186.69603
70.7945786 188.324417
89.1250916 190.250046
112.201843 192.29512
141.253754 194.402451
177.827942 196.805237
223.872116 199.302124
281.838287 201.937424
354.813385 204.740341
446.683594 207.721512
562.341309 210.779861
707.945801 214.008194
891.250916 217.301636
1122.01843 220.825027
0.112201847 493.387238
0.141253754 458.359528
0.177827939 418.318909
0.22387211 373.911285
0.281838298 319.928436
0.354813397 283.0914
0.446683586 268.534058
0.562341332 276.086823
0.707945764 272.393768
0.891250908 256.016174
1.12201846 244.75618
1.41253757 240.02301
1.77827942 235.419708
2.23872113 231.370941
2.81838298 227.435486
3.54813385 223.667374
4.46683598 220.012894
5.62341309 216.601257
7.07945776 213.35112
8.91250896 210.31044
11.2201843 207.624191
14.1253757 205.217499
17.782795 203.115402
22.3872108 201.347778
28.1838284 199.922699
35.4813385 198.905243
44.6683578 198.281769
56.2341309 197.968994
70.7945786 198.065216
89.1250916 198.56514
112.201843 199.439362
141.253754 200.624985
177.827942 202.279434
223.872116 204.292862
281.838287 206.637161
354.813385 209.354752
446.683594 212.372726
562.341309 215.788147
707.945801 219.447098
891.250916 223.456558
1122.01843 227.742752
0.112201847 314.060791
0.141253754 298.15625
0.177827939 278.815308
0.22387211 256.318756
0.281838298 233.202927
0.354813397 216.659943
0.446683586 211.074036
0.562341332 203.930725
0.707945764 202.305923
0.891250908 201.86142
1.12201846 202.088837
1.41253757 202.516144
1.77827942 202.437973
2.23872113 202.437973
2.81838298 199.624069
3.54813385 195.577286
4.46683598 191.70311
5.62341309 188.170792
7.07945776 185.007034
8.91250896 182.178665
11.2201843 179.614639
14.1253757 177.521149
17.782795 175.741989
22.3872108 174.436356
28.1838284 173.297104
35.4813385 172.519257
44.6683578 172.116669
56.2341309 171.974335
70.7945786 172.191788
89.1250916 172.676147
112.201843 173.460251
141.253754 174.544327
177.827942 175.636078
223.872116 177.048355
281.838287 178.711197
354.813385 180.575378
446.683594 182.522659
562.341309 184.719925
707.945801 187.063477
891.250916 189.527618
1122.01843 192.146408
0.112201847 421.345184
0.141253754 398.92746
0.177827939 368.719666
0.22387211 330.923645
0.281838298 307.647766
0.354813397 295.79895
0.446683586 296.558319
0.562341332 314.576141
0.707945764 337.36319
0.891250908 352.002045
1.12201846 362.539642
1.41253757 360.914185
1.77827942 359.911346
2.23872113 359.942657
2.81838298 355.112244
3.54813385 351.557648
4.46683598 349.431091
5.62341309 347.26181
7.07945776 345.238922
8.91250896 343.614594
11.2201843 341.263306
14.1253757 339.308807
17.782795 337.696472
22.3872108 336.307129
28.1838284 335.221222
35.4813385 334.441956
44.6683578 333.785492
56.2341309 333.440979
70.7945786 333.316864
89.1250916 333.495911
112.201843 333.901001
141.253754 334.591675
177.827942 335.515472
223.872116 336.70224
281.838287 338.203857
354.813385 340.014282
446.683594 342.059265
562.341309 344.288025
707.945801 346.753387
891.250916 349.679443
1122.01843 352.527405
0.112201847 813.703857
0.141253754 775.777832
0.177827939 733.947266
0.22387211 697.468323
0.281838298 662.679016
0.354813397 635.602783
0.446683586 609.006836
0.562341332 587.976196
0.707945764 571.831177
0.891250908 551.290894
1.12201846 537.868469
1.41253757 518.825562
1.77827942 504.359497
2.23872113 489.070007
2.81838298 473.330139
3.54813385 455.979218
4.46683598 440.94519
5.62341309 428.88739
7.07945776 417.966034
8.91250896 407.687988
11.2201843 398.534454
14.1253757 390.372467
17.782795 382.919403
22.3872108 376.394165
28.1838284 370.719604
35.4813385 366.100861
44.6683578 361.942993
56.2341309 358.761902
70.7945786 356.173828
89.1250916 353.897461
112.201843 352.455841
141.253754 351.594757
177.827942 351.013092
223.872116 350.895874
281.838287 351.086639
354.813385 351.73819
446.683594 352.464508
562.341309 353.643219
707.945801 355.161987
891.250916 356.964478
1122.01843 358.761902
0.112201847 422.512238
0.141253754 399.196045
0.177827939 367.01886
0.22387211 333.053314
0.281838298 306.458008
0.354813397 294.634216
0.446683586 299.998627
0.562341332 315.260193
0.707945764 337.004822
0.891250908 351.361786
1.12201846 359.061127
1.41253757 361.975555
1.77827942 359.911346
2.23872113 359.942657
2.81838298 355.112244
3.54813385 351.557648
4.46683598 349.431091
5.62341309 347.26181
7.07945776 345.238922
8.91250896 343.614594
11.2201843 341.263306
14.1253757 339.308807
17.782795 337.696472
22.3872108 336.307129
28.1838284 335.221222
35.4813385 334.441956
44.6683578 333.785492
56.2341309 333.440979
70.7945786 333.316864
89.1250916 333.495911
112.201843 333.901001